GPR43 agonist 1
GPR43 agonist 1 is a selective, orally active GPR43 agonist. GPR43 agonist 1 downregulates the activity of NF-κB. GPR43 agonist 1 can be used in studies of acute colitis.

Biological Activity
|
GPR43 |
GPR43 agonist 1 (Compound 187) selectively inhibits cAMP production in HEK293-hGPR43 cells, with an EC50 value of 16 nM[1].
GPR43 agonist 1 is a potent positive allosteric agonist that induces Ca2+ influx in HEK293-hGPR43 cells, with enhanced potency in the presence of acetic acid[1].
GPR43 agonist 1 (treated for 25 min, incubated for 1 h) acts as a partial positive allosteric agonist, which induces the GPR43-β-arrestin 2 interaction in HEK293-hGPR43 cells, with enhanced activity in the presence of acetate[1].
GPR43 agonist 1 (pretreated for 20 min and co-incubated with 10 ng/mL TNF-α for 6 h) potently inhibits TNF-α-induced NF-κB activity in HEK293-hGPR43 cells, with an EC50 of 19 nM[1].
GPR43 agonist 1 reverses TNF-α-induced IκBα degradation in HEK293-hGPR43 cells[1].

Animal Model:C57BL/6 (female, 6 weeks old post-acclimation)[1]
-
Dosage:30 mg/kg
-
Administration:p.o.; daily; 8 days
-
Result:Reduced myeloperoxidase (MPO) staining in colon tissue compared to vehicle-treated DSS-induced colitis mice.
Showed no significant change in colon length relative to vehicle-treated mice.
Reported no significant reductions in body weight loss score, rectal bleeding score, stool consistency score, or daily activity index relative to vehicle-treated mice.
